Vanuatu: Landslides and torrential floods hinder aid measures on Ambae | World News

In Vanuatu's Ambae Islands, a mudslide and a torrent make it difficult to evacuate, as up to 800 refugees are housed in disaster recovery shelters. Home to 11,000 humans, Ambae Iceland is the second in six month that Manaro has begun to rumble on Mount Lombenbenben and spit out streams of volcanic dust, gases and craters.

The incumbent Premier Jean Pierre Nirua said Vanuatu is the most fragile nation in the worid for catastrophes and is currently overwhelmed by the clean-up of Hola last months and the developing Ambae crisis.

The Vanuatu meteorologists and Geohazard's division say the volume will remain at stage three, with a hazard area around the three kilometre conical area. The eruptive action had broadened the cones of the vulcano, resulting in falling incineration, gases and sour rains as well as an increased hazard of landslips and overturns.

Vanuatu Red Cross's Olivia Finau said it was likely that it would stay on for some longer, which would force the administration to permanently relocate Ambae's islanders to the islands near by. Several neighboring chieftains had already offered plots of property suited for resettlement to the state. It is difficult for NGOs and civil servants to gain entry to the islands after a British flag carrier canceled a flight, which forces the US authorities to start chartering an aircraft on Tuesday. The south of Ambae was the hardest affected by the ashtray and the Unicef staff on the floor said that those with bronchial obstructions or other airway difficulties were having trouble inhaling.

"It' s really a challenge for the affected church, it is their home and everything they know, they've been there all their lives," said Cate Heinrich, head of Uncief Pacific's communication department, and added that there were more than 5,000 kids on Ambae. A number of colleges were shut down, and there was a feeling of suspense as local people were waiting for the federal administration to set a timeline for evacuations that was much slower and safer than last year's do-it-yourself evacuations, Heinrich said.

A $120,000 check was presented by Liu Quan, the China embassador, to the Vanuatua administration on Monday to help with the operations. Twenty-two feet to assist early resumption of work for those affected by the Ambae Vulcano last year, and is willing to give further help, a spokesman said.

New Zealand's authorities have provided more than NZ$1.5 million in aid, as well as providing equipment and shelter. Not unfamiliar to catastrophes, Vanuatu's 83 islets are in the midst of cyclone avenue and puncture the boundary of the Ring of Fire - a Pacific beltway that is susceptible to seismic and volcanoes.
